Kalpataru IPO listing summary
Kalpataru (Real Estate) closed its IPO window in 2025 and listed on NSE and BSE on 01 July 2025 at an upper band issue price of Rs 414, opening at Rs 414 for a listing gain of 0.0% and closing day one at Rs 432.95 (+4.6% on closing basis). The IPO was subscribed 2.26x overall - QIB 3.12x, HNI/NII 1.31x, Retail 1.29x. The total issue size was Rs 1,590 Cr (Fresh Issue Rs 1590 Cr, OFS Rs 0 Cr). Kalpataru IPO GMP history
Grey market premium (GMP) tracked day-by-day across the IPO window. Absolute GMP is the premium in rupees over the upper issue price; GMP % is that premium as a percent of the issue price.
| Day | GMP (Rs) | GMP % |
|---|---|---|
| Day 1 | Rs 9 | +2.17% |
| Day 2 | Rs 9 | +2.17% |
| Day 3 | Rs 7 | +1.69% |
| Day 4 | Rs 10 | +2.42% |
| Day 5 | Rs 5 | +1.21% |
